85615-54-9

85615-54-9 structure
85615-54-9 structure

Name 1-ethyl 20-methyl (5S,6Z,8E,10E,12R,14Z)-5-(benzoyloxy)-12-hydroxyicosa-6,8,10,14-tetraenedioate
Molecular Formula C30H40O7
Molecular Weight 512.63400
Exact Mass 512.27700
PSA 99.13000
LogP 5.65460
Precursor  0

DownStream  1